Gazala Gawazat vs Itapeva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Gazala Gawazat, Sudan and Itapeva, Brazil is approximately 9,073 km or 5,638 mi.
  • To reach Gazala Gawazat in this distance one would set out from Itapeva bearing 73.4°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Gazala Gawazat bearing 63.3° or ENE .
  • Gazala Gawazat has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h) whereas Itapeva has a subtropical highland climate with no dry season (Cfb).
  • Gazala Gawazat is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Itapeva is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 9.6 °C (17.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1 °C (1.8°F) more in Gazala Gawazat.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 793.7 mm (31.2 in) less which is equivalent to 793.7 l/m² (19.48 US gal/ft²) or 7,937,000 l/ha (848,518 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8° higher in Gazala Gawazat than in Itapeva.
  • Relative humidity levels are 33.2%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 1.7°C (3.1°F) lower.
